What this workflow does

This all-in-one solution transforms ideas into fully produced short-form videos through a 5-step process:

  1. Generate video captions from ideas stored in a Google Sheet
  2. Create AI-generated images using Flux and the OpenAI API
  3. Convert images to videos using Kling's API
  4. Add voice-overs to your content with Eleven Labs
  5. Complete the video production with Creatomate by adding templates, transitions, and combining all elements

The workflow handles everything from sourcing content ideas to rendering the final video, and even notifies you on Discord when videos are ready.

How to customize this workflow to your needs

  • Adjust the Google Sheet structure to include additional data like video length, duration, style, etc.
  • Modify the prompt templates for each AI service to match your brand voice and content style
  • Update the Creatomate template to reflect your visual branding
  • Configure notification preferences in Discord to manage your workflow
